Large-Scale In-Situ Thermal Desorption of Refinery Hydrocarbon Contamination at Gela Refinery, Italy

Up to 80,000 m³ of soils contaminated with hydrocarbons and mercury were treated through a multi-batch In-Situ Thermal Desorption program, demonstrating the effectiveness of ISTD for large-scale refinery remediation while achieving the cleanup objectives required by Italian regulations.
